Regression: Misalignment of content is seen after changing flag to RTL
Reported by
nutan.ga...@etouch.net,
Nov 17 2017
|
||||||||||
Issue descriptionVersion: 64.0.3271.0 71f07f2c6c77c9e67158a193516e2f0c6229ce64-refs/heads/master@{#517250} 32/64 bits OS: Windows (7,8,8.1,10),Linux (14.04 LTS),Mac OS X(10.12.6,10.13.1) Steps to reproduce? 1. Launch chrome, navigate to chrome://flags and change 'Force UI direction' to 'Right-to-Left' 2. Relaunch chrome, navigate to 'Unavailable' tab and observe the alignment of content Actual: Misalignment of content is seen after changing flag to RTL Expected: Alignment should be proper This is Regression issue seen from M-64 and will soon update bisect info: Good Build - 64.0.3254.0 Bad Build - 64.0.3255.0
,
Nov 17 2017
Adding release blocker for this issue.Please undo if not the case. Thank You!
,
Nov 17 2017
That CL doesn't affect webcontent - can you retry the bisect?
,
Nov 21 2017
With respect to comment 3: Re bisected for the above issue and getting below CL: You are probably looking for a change made after 512799 (known good), but no later than 512800 (first known bad). CHANGELOG URL: The script might not always return single CL as suspect as some perf builds might get missing due to failure. https://chromium.googlesource.com/chromium/src/+log/d53727e2c524a1c67bb666a19aa9b35f8e16f871..bf18e6e1fdcad9abe6395c8ed47bb16e90063b25 Suspect: https://chromium.googlesource.com/chromium/src/+/bf18e6e1fdcad9abe6395c8ed47bb16e90063b25
,
Nov 21 2017
Thanks for catching this. I'll look at a fix shortly.
,
Nov 29 2017
Still we are able to reproduce the issue on Windows 7 , Mac 10.12.6 & Ubuntu 14.04 using latest Canary-64.0.3279.0 as per C#0. edwardjung@,As it is marked as stable blocker,could you please take a look and update the thread accordingly. Thank you..!
,
Nov 29 2017
CL 788916 was just submitted. Should land shortly to fix this issue.
,
Nov 30 2017
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/4aa17b6fd8bd45e76480c64883bb09afa239b439 commit 4aa17b6fd8bd45e76480c64883bb09afa239b439 Author: Edward Jung <edwardjung@chromium.org> Date: Thu Nov 30 01:57:04 2017 chrome://flags layout fixes + Fix misaligning of content when displayed RTL. + Fix overlapping header and version number on smaller / zoomed screens. Bug: 788299 , 786307 Change-Id: If722cc1a9188ca7837049c29b3f67e3b9bf27c69 Reviewed-on: https://chromium-review.googlesource.com/788916 Commit-Queue: Edward Jung <edwardjung@chromium.org> Reviewed-by: Michael Giuffrida <michaelpg@chromium.org> Cr-Commit-Position: refs/heads/master@{#520386} [modify] https://crrev.com/4aa17b6fd8bd45e76480c64883bb09afa239b439/components/flags_ui/resources/flags.css
,
Nov 30 2017
Note: Retested the above issue on latest Canary #64.0.3281.0 on Windows (7,8,10),Linux (14.04 LTS), Mac(10.12.6) and fix is working as intended.
,
Nov 30 2017
Thanks Nutan
,
Nov 30 2017
[Auto-generated comment by a script] We noticed that this issue is targeted for M-64; it appears the fix may have landed after branch point, meaning a merge might be required. Please confirm if a merge is required here - if so add Merge-Request-64 label, otherwise remove Merge-TBD label. Thanks.
,
Nov 30 2017
Shouldn't need a merge. The CL has landed in 64. |
||||||||||
►
Sign in to add a comment |
||||||||||
Comment 1 by nutan.ga...@etouch.net
, Nov 17 2017Owner: tapted@chromium.org
Status: Assigned (was: Unconfirmed)